The Verse-Book of a Homely Woman 


By Fay Inchfawn (1880-1978) < 

Published by the Religious Tract Society in London, The Verse-Book of o ? 

m Homely Woman is a collection of domestic, spiritual, and fanciful poems g 

from the point of view of a woman, a housewife, and a Christian. The 

natural, supernatural, and solidly mundane are mixed together as well as oT 

separated into two parts: Indoors and Outdoors. (Summary by Clarica) o
